Gwinnett County, GA vs York County, PA

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025

Quick Answer

Gwinnett County, GA: 0.86% effective rate · $1,964/yr median tax · median home $228,410

York County, PA: 1.52% effective rate · $3,690/yr median tax · median home $242,822

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Gwinnett County and York County?
Gwinnett County, GA has an effective property tax rate of 0.86% with a median annual tax of $1,964. York County, PA has a rate of 1.52% with a median annual tax of $3,690. The difference is 0.66 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Gwinnett County or York County?
York County, PA has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.52% compared to 0.86%.
How do Gwinnett County and York County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Gwinnett County is below average at 0.86%, and York County is above average at 1.52%.
